The Tekken franchise has been a cornerstone of the fighting game community for decades. Among its many iterations, Tekken Tag Tournament 2 (TTT2) holds a special place. Released originally for arcades, PlayStation 3, and Xbox 360, it boasted the largest roster in series history—over 50 characters—and introduced the chaotic, rewarding 2v2 tag mechanic. For years, Android gamers have dreamed of playing this masterpiece on their phones.
But here’s the catch: Tekken Tag Tournament 2 was never officially released for PlayStation Portable (PSP) or mobile devices. So how do YouTubers and tech forums keep talking about "Tekken Tag Tournament 2 PPSSPP Android Download"?
The answer is emulation—specifically, using the powerful PPSSPP emulator to run a modified or downscaled version of the game.
